黑狐家游戏

加密技术主要分为几类,加密技术主要分为,揭秘加密技术,从古典密码到现代算法的演变历程

欧气 0 0
加密技术主要分为揭秘加密技术,涵盖古典密码到现代算法的演变历程。本文深入探讨各类加密技术及其发展,旨在揭示加密技术背后的原理和演变过程。

本文目录导读:

  1. 古典密码
  2. 对称加密
  3. 非对称加密
  4. 哈希加密

随着信息技术的飞速发展,数据安全成为人们关注的焦点,加密技术作为保护信息安全的重要手段,已经成为了现代社会不可或缺的一部分,加密技术主要分为古典密码、对称加密、非对称加密和哈希加密四大类,下面,让我们一起来揭秘这四大类加密技术。

加密技术主要分为几类,加密技术主要分为,揭秘加密技术,从古典密码到现代算法的演变历程

图片来源于网络,如有侵权联系删除

古典密码

古典密码是加密技术的起源,最早可以追溯到古代,这类加密方法主要包括替换密码、转置密码和换位密码等,替换密码是将明文中的每个字符替换成另一个字符,如凯撒密码;转置密码则是将明文中的字符按照一定的规则进行重新排列,如列式密码;换位密码则是将明文中的字符按照一定的顺序进行排列,如维吉尼亚密码。

古典密码的优点在于简单易行,但缺点是安全性较低,容易被破解,随着计算机技术的发展,古典密码逐渐被现代加密技术所取代。

对称加密

对称加密是指加密和解密使用相同的密钥,这类加密方法主要包括DES、AES、Blowfish等,对称加密的优点是加密速度快,实现简单,适合处理大量数据,但其缺点是密钥分发困难,安全性依赖于密钥的保密性。

1、DES(Data Encryption Standard):是美国国家标准与技术研究院(NIST)于1977年颁布的加密标准,DES使用56位密钥,将64位明文分成8组,经过16轮加密,最终生成64位密文。

2、AES(Advanced Encryption Standard):是NIST于2001年颁布的加密标准,取代了DES,AES支持128位、192位和256位密钥长度,具有更高的安全性。

加密技术主要分为几类,加密技术主要分为,揭秘加密技术,从古典密码到现代算法的演变历程

图片来源于网络,如有侵权联系删除

3、Blowfish:是由Bruce Schneier于1993年设计的对称加密算法,Blowfish使用64位密钥,支持128位到448位密文长度,具有较高的安全性。

非对称加密

非对称加密是指加密和解密使用不同的密钥,分为公钥和私钥,这类加密方法主要包括RSA、ECC等,非对称加密的优点是解决了密钥分发问题,安全性较高,但其缺点是加密速度较慢,适合处理少量数据。

1、RSA:是由Ron Rivest、Adi Shamir和Leonard Adleman于1977年提出的非对称加密算法,RSA使用两个密钥,公钥用于加密,私钥用于解密。

2、ECC(Elliptic Curve Cryptography):是基于椭圆曲线数学的非对称加密算法,ECC具有更高的安全性,且密钥长度较短,适合移动设备和嵌入式系统。

哈希加密

哈希加密是一种将任意长度的数据映射为固定长度的散列值的算法,这类加密方法主要包括MD5、SHA-1、SHA-256等,哈希加密的优点是安全性高,不易被破解,但其缺点是只能单向加密,无法解密。

加密技术主要分为几类,加密技术主要分为,揭秘加密技术,从古典密码到现代算法的演变历程

图片来源于网络,如有侵权联系删除

1、MD5:是美国国家标准与技术研究院于1991年颁布的哈希算法,MD5将任意长度的数据映射为128位散列值。

2、SHA-1:是美国国家标准与技术研究院于1995年颁布的哈希算法,SHA-1将任意长度的数据映射为160位散列值。

3、SHA-256:是美国国家标准与技术研究院于2001年颁布的哈希算法,SHA-256将任意长度的数据映射为256位散列值。

加密技术已经从古典密码发展到现代算法,为信息安全提供了强有力的保障,在信息时代,掌握加密技术的重要性不言而喻。

标签: #加密技术分类

黑狐家游戏
  • 评论列表

留言评论